| Tank Size | 1000 - 3000 L |
|---|---|
| Bellow Diameters | 815 / 913 mm |
| Air Speed | 40 - 45 m/s |
| Tire | 295/80-15.3 |
| Noise level at a distance of 7.5 m (815/913) | 89.5 dB/92 dB |
| Tractor (815/913) | ≥ 50 hp/≥ 65 hp |
| Distribution UP (815/913) | 8m/9m |
| Distribution to the side (815/913) | 9m/10m |
| Arches Degania- 815 (mechanical) | 2 large (26×2) = 52 nozzles |
|---|---|
| Arches Degania -815 (mechanical) | 2 large + 2 small (26×2 + 16×2) = 84 nozzles |
| Arches Degania - 815 (electric/computer) | 2 large (26×2) = 52 nozzles or 2 large + 2 small (26×2 + 16×2) = 84 nozzles |
| Arches Degania -815 (mechanical/electric) | 4 large (26×4) = 104 nozzles |
| Arches Degania - 913 (mechanical/electric/computer) | 2 large (28×2) = 56 nozzles |
| Arches Degania - 913 (mechanical/electric) | 2 large + 2 small (28×2 + 19×2) = 94 nozzles |
| Arches Degania - 913 (mechanical/electric/computer) | 4 large (28×4) = 112 nozzles |
| Arches from Fieni | 2 short arches (7+7) = 14 nozzles |
| Line Filter & Regulator | 3/4" line filter with mechanical pressure regulator (mechanical setup) |
| Pump Flow | Piston 110 L/min; Diaphragm: 150/170 L/min |
| Stirrer | Mechanical or hydraulic |
| Pumps | Bertolini (Italy): CKA-110-P; PBO-1540.1 VD; POLY-2180 VD |
|---|---|
| Nozzles | Ceramic Albuz |
| Control Options | Mechanical manifold / electric valves / computer (2 sections) |
| Filters | 3/4" line filter with pressure regulator (mechanical setups) |
| Sensor | Speed |
| Bellow Fan Options | Fieni: D.815-48VNS/D.913-56VNS |
| PTO Shaft | Protected, 64 HP |
| Drive Type | Axle-to-axle via coupling (shaft-to-shaft) |
| Rear lights | Multifunction |
| Mounting | Quick-hitch or 3-point linkage |
| Reel+hose+spray gun | Optional |
| Basket front/rear | Optional |
| Tank | Stainless Steel |
|---|---|
| Arches | Stainless steel |
| Bellow Wings | Plastic with adjustable angle |
| Leaf Guard | Stainless Steel |
| Frame | Steel with anti-corrosion coating |
| Front/rear basket | Stainless Steel |
| Hoses | PVC-40Bar |
Flagship orchard spraying with in-cab control and serious daily productivity
SUFA 913/815 Trailed Sprayer is a flagship orchard sprayer built for growers who need a high-capacity machine for professional crop protection in demanding commercial plantations. It is especially suited to orchards with medium to large canopy volume, structured row planting, and intensive seasonal treatment programs, where the machine must deliver strong air-assisted coverage, long working autonomy, and dependable operation throughout the day. With stainless steel tank capacities from 1000 to 3000 L, SUFA is designed for farms that need fewer refill stops, higher daily productivity, and a more efficient spraying routine across larger orchard blocks.
The machine is based on Fieni 815 or 913 bellows fan options, delivering 40–45 m/s air speed with spray distribution of up to 8–9 m upward and 9–10 m to the side. This makes it highly effective in orchards where canopy height, side reach, and row structure directly affect treatment quality. One of its most important practical advantages is that the spraying process can be controlled from the tractor cabin through mechanical manifold, electric valves, or computer control, depending on configuration. The system can work with speed input, and the computer can operate with field-speed data for more controlled application during orchard work. In real daily use, that means better operator comfort, more consistent spraying logic, and more confident control during long working hours in heat, dust, and demanding seasonal conditions.
Flexible orchard platform for accurate treatment and practical field use
The real strength of SUFA 913/815 is not only its tank size, but the way the machine combines airflow, control, and working flexibility into one orchard platform. It can be equipped with Bertolini pump options, including CKA-110-P, PBO-1540.1 VD, and POLY-2180 VD, together with Ceramic Albuz nozzles and multiple spray-system configurations. Depending on setup, the machine supports 52 to 112 nozzles, while also offering optional layouts and configurations that allow the sprayer to be matched to different orchard structures, tree volumes, and working programs. This gives the grower a much more adaptable machine for repeated orchard treatment, rather than one rigid spraying setup.
SUFA is also built as a practical working machine for difficult agricultural conditions. Its controlled air-assisted spraying helps support more uniform application, which in real farm work can contribute to more careful use of water and crop-protection materials by reducing unnecessary overlap and improving treatment consistency. That matters even more in hot regions and under long seasonal workloads, where efficiency, accuracy, and stable performance are critical. The machine can also be equipped with optional front and rear baskets for carrying chemical containers, tools, and field accessories, and with optional reel, hose, and spray gun for precise spot treatment when direct manual spraying is needed. This makes SUFA more than a standard trailed orchard sprayer — it becomes a versatile field-use platform that combines large-scale orchard spraying with practical day-to-day utility.
